This is a horrible beer and deserves a rating below 1 for most of these categories...
Starts off with a nasty cheap, rotten egg smell that I have come to associate with all Glueks beers....it's not old...it's just their smell....must be their yeast strain...LOL...Taste has ZERO hefe weizen characteristics....put this in a blind taste test with the best tasters in the world and they would never guess it to be a Hefe or even a wheat beer at all....taste is sourish...not a good sour either...other than that there isn't much in the way of flavor at all....body is relatively thin...just a bad beer...stay away...

Hazy pale yellow, respectable fine-bubbled head. Aroma is citrusy -- maybe, more subdued than I expected but with some off notes, almost sulfurous. Flavor is rough and grainy, yeasty. Artificial lemon candy. Some might find this refreshing, but it emphasizes aspects of Wheats that put me off. Mouthfeel is decent, especially at the front. Not a favorite...
